Many have been wondering how Gregory's failed test will affect his draft status.

The latest example I can come up with is Justin Houston. He was regarded as a first rounder and a top 20 talent by many. Then goes on to piss hot for marijuana at the combine, as a result, he slides into the 3rd round.

This very well could be Gregory's projection as well when you take in other factors like, the depth of this class and questions about his weight.

Just something to chew on. Doesn't mean it will happen. One thing is for certain, failed drug tests and a history with said drug will push a player down GM's big boards regardless of talent.
